Job Title: Admin Ass't to Prop, Mngr
Company: Confidential
Location: New York, NY
Description:
CONSTRUCTION MANAGEMENT SUPPORT
Prepare budget folders for all tenant improvements and capital projects; Follow through approval process; Assist Property Manager with tracking construction payments; coordinate receipt of Lien Releases before final payments are made to contractors
Obtain insurance certificates from contractors as required; Distribute to Legal Departments; Insure insurance certificates are current and up-to-date
Coordinate paperwork for obtaining construction permits, lien releases, and certificates of occupancy
Schedule work with contractors for tenants.
OPERATIONS
Facilitate timely responses to Tenant inquiries and disputes
Insure correct and timely notification to Utility firms of new tenants as new tenants take possession of premises or as tenants vacate premises; Confirm with Utility firm
Insure correct billing of ‘house’ telephone accounts
Notify General Manager and Legal Department of Insurance Claims, Accident Reports, and/or Violations; Track progress; Assist Property Manager in generating Monthly Status Report
Coordinate emergencies, work orders, and site inspections with on-site and/or field personnel
ACCOUNTING
Prepare budget folders for tenant improvements, leasing commissions, and capital projects; Follow through approval process; Follow up and track progress payment(s)
Coordinate Accounting Department information flow; facilitate the monthly review and analysis of the project budget and variances
Assist Property Manager in preparation of annual budgets as needed; Coordinate the release of security deposits and letter of credits as tenants vacate as directed by Property Manager
Code all invoices for payment; Circulate for appropriate approvals; Handle inquiries from vendors; Follow up
LEASING / TRANSACTION SUPPORT
Coordinate Tenant move-ins & move-outs: keys, utilities, track possession dates, etc
Coordinate information flow between Leasing Department and Property Management Department
Forward Accounting Department all new or updated tenant information
Assist in rent collection process.
MAIL
Open & read all mail related to portfolio; Screen for urgent responses; Distribute to appropriate party; Follow up
Fax or deliver Violations, Insurance Claims, and/or Accident Reports immediately to Legal Department and third party property managers, if applicable; Notify Property Manager; Track progress; Follow up
Coordinate mailings as necessary: overnight, regular and registered mailings, etc
TELEPHONES
Answer telephone line; Direct or handle calls and/or inquiries appropriately and efficiently; Discuss issue; Resolve, if possible, & follow up;
Log in tenant complaints per pre-approved format.
FILING & COPYING
Create, organize and maintain files, including labeling, containing:
1. Property Operations Files
2. Appraisals
3. Engineering Reports
4. Environmental Reports
5. Property Photographs
6. Building & Tenant Space Plans
Copy and file correspondence, executed documents, etc. in appropriate files
Copy and forward hard or electronic copies to appropriate departments
ELECTRONIC FILING
Organize and maintain Portfolio Operations file(s) in Data Central
TYPING & CORRESPONDENCE
Type and/or draft correspondence & transmittals as required
MISCELLANEOUS:
Schedule and confirm appointments; Schedule and confirm conference room, if needed; Coordinate food and beverage orders in advance of meetings, as required; Set up conference room before and clear up after meetings, as needed
Arrange rental cars, car reservation, itineraries for various site visits as necessary
Detailed copying and distribution of documents
Help with the preparation and distribution of the annual Business Plan and any other presentation as needed
Coordinate information flow between Leasing Department, Accounting Department, and Property Management Department
Provide backup to reception.
LIBRARY
File and maintain periodicals, reference books, newsletters, and brochures as pertains to Property Management Department
Insure that all reference materials are the most current.
Other Duties as Assigned
